Advertisement

iOS毕业设计电商网站源码,要求具备Swift或Objective-C开发技能。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
毕业设计电商网站源码XLsn0wiOSDeveloperReactiveCocoa(通常简称为RAC),是由GitHub开源的一个应用于iOS和操作系统开发的框架。ReactiveCocoa究竟是做什么的?ReactiveCocoa的具体作用是什么?在我们的iOS开发过程中,当某些事件发生响应时,往往需要对这些事件进行相应的业务逻辑处理,而这些事件采用不同的方式进行处理,例如按钮点击使用Action、ScrollView滚动使用Delegate、属性值改变使用KVO等系统提供的机制。实际上,这些事件都可以通过RAC来处理。ReactiveCocoa提供了大量的事件处理方法,并且利用RAC进行事件处理非常便捷,它允许我们将要处理的事情以及监听事情的代码整合在一起,从而极大地简化了我们的管理工作,避免了频繁地跳转到对应的方法中。这种设计方式与我们开发中追求高聚合、低耦合的理念高度契合。该博客文章作者的描述已经清晰地阐述了这一点;如果用一句话概括,ReactiveCocoa本质上就是一个为我们提供事件处理服务的第三方框架!学习资源通过总结常见的编程思想来介绍ReactiveCocoa框架,它将所知的编程...

全部评论 (0)

还没有任何评论哟~
客服
客服
  • iOS-Swift/Objective-C
    优质
    本项目为一款电商网站的iOS客户端应用源代码,采用Swift和Objective-C开发。适合掌握这两种编程语言的学生或开发者作为学习参考或实践使用。 毕业设计电商网站源码XLsn0wiOSDeveloperReactiveCocoa(简称RAC)是一个由GitHub开源的框架,用于iOS和OS开发。ReactiveCocoa的作用是帮助处理事件。在我们的iOS开发过程中,当某些事件被触发时需要进行相应的业务逻辑操作,这些事件通常通过不同的方式来处理:例如按钮点击使用action、ScrollView滚动使用delegate、属性值变化则使用KVO等系统提供的方法。 然而,所有这些事件都可以用ReactiveCocoa框架来进行统一的管理。它为各种类型的事件提供了多种处理手段,并且利用RAC可以非常方便地将需要执行的操作与监听到的事件代码放在一起编写,这样便于管理和维护。这符合我们开发中提倡的高聚合、低耦合的设计理念。 简而言之,ReactiveCocoa是一个用于帮助开发者更高效管理各种事件的第三方框架。在学习这个框架时,作者通过总结常见的编程思想来介绍其功能和使用方法。
  • 优质
    本项目旨在开发一个功能完善的电子商务平台,涵盖商品展示、在线交易及用户评价等模块,致力于为用户提供便捷高效的购物体验。 目录 1. 设计题目 1.1 简单电子商务网站设计 2. 设计要求 2.1 开发工具: 2.2 数据库: 2.2.1 系统数据库介绍: 2.2.2 JSP与JDBC访问数据库: 3. 网上书店的可行性分析及需求分析 3.1系统可行性分析 3.1.1技术可行性 3.1.2经济可行性 3.1.3操作可行性 3.2 系统功能分析 3.2.1 用户模块部分的主要功能: 3.2.2 管理员模块部分的主要功能: 4.网上书店系统的总体设计 4.1 用户模块介绍 4.2 管理员模块介绍 4.3 数据库介绍: 4.3.1 实体—关系图 4.3.2 数据表结构 5.网上书店系统的详细设计 5.1 系统结构分析 5.1.1 注册功能流程图 5.1.2 用户登录流程图 5.1.3 购物车流程图 5.1.4 购物流程图 5.1.5 书籍搜索流程图 5.1.6 书籍管理流程图 5.2 主要功能的实现 5.2.1 用户模块主页面 5.2.2 用户注册及用户信息管理 5.2.3 用户登陆 5.2.4 管理员登录 5.2.6 添加书籍类别 5.2.7 添加出版社 5.2.8 添加书籍 5.2.9 订单管理 5.2.10 购物车 6.主要代码实现 6.1 处理书籍上传的代码 6.2 搜索功能的JAVASCRIPT代码 7.系统测试 7.1 测试环境 7.2 测试内容 7.3 测试结果 8.总结 参考文献
  • ASP-SQLServer论文
    优质
    本资源包包含一个采用ASP与SQL Server技术开发的电子商务网站完整源代码,适合用作高校毕业生的项目实践或论文研究。 毕业设计电商网站源码下载地址:项目介绍(ASP+SQL Server电子商务源码+论文系统)——某某大学某某学院毕业论文 目 录 摘要…………………………………………………………………………………3 Abstract……………………………………………………………………………4 前言…………………………………………………………………………………5 第一章 系统概述 ……………………………………………………………6 1.1 本课题的研究意义 ………………………………………………………6 1.2 本论文的目的、内容及发展趋势 ………………………………………6 1.3 作者的主要贡献 …………………………………………………………6 第二章 销售网站系统概述 …………………………………………………8 2.1 销售模型现状 ……………………………………………………………8 2.2 网站系统开发方法介绍 …………………………………………………8 第三章 系统调研及可行性分析 …………………………………………12 3.1 系统调研 ……
  • 优质
    本项目为电子商务网站的设计与实现,旨在开发一个功能全面、用户体验优秀的在线购物平台。通过此项目研究和实践,深化了对电商系统架构及用户界面设计的理解。 开发一个架构清晰的电子商务系统——电子购物商城(eshop),该系统主要为消费者提供商品宣传及在线购物功能。采用Microsoft公司的ASP.NET开发工具,并以C#为核心语言,结合微软IIS 5.0作为运行环境,同时利用Microsoft SQL Server 2000来建立数据库连接和设计页面。这种基于ASP.NET与SQL Server的开发方式在业界已经相当成熟,在国内也有广泛的应用基础。此外,通过引入XML技术可以构建出更加灵活且功能丰富的电子商务系统。因此,本项目选择使用这套工具和技术栈进行开发。
  • 优质
    本项目旨在开发一个功能全面、操作便捷的电子商务平台,涵盖商品展示、购物车管理、订单处理及用户评价等模块,为用户提供优质的在线购物体验。 【购物网站毕业设计】是一个典型的IT项目,适合学生进行实战练习并提升综合技能。该项目涵盖了网页开发的多个重要方面,包括用户登录、商品展示、会话管理以及聊天功能等,是学习ASP(Active Server Pages)技术及其相关概念的良好实例。 1. **用户登录系统**:login.asp和login_check.asp文件构成了用户登录流程的关键部分。login.asp用于收集用户的用户名及密码信息,而login_check.asp则负责验证这些数据,并与数据库中的记录进行匹配以确认身份。在实际的购物网站中,确保交易安全的基础就是通过严格的认证过程来防止SQL注入等安全隐患。 2. **页面展示**:display.asp可能被用来显示商品列表或详情页内容,这涉及到从数据库检索信息并动态生成HTML的过程。开发者需要掌握如何使用ASP技术结合ADO(ActiveX Data Objects)进行数据操作和查询,从而将数据库中的静态数据转化为用户友好的格式。 3. **会话管理**:session_check.asp与Web.config文件用于管理和配置用户的会话状态。在ASP中,Session对象被用来存储每个用户的登录状况等信息;而Web.config则是ASP.NET应用的设置文件,可以设定诸如会话超时时间、应用程序全局变量等内容。理解并掌握这些机制对于实现用户购物车和个性化推荐等功能至关重要。 4. **聊天功能**:talk.asp、chartroom.asp、exit.asp以及session_check.asp共同构建了一个简单的在线聊天系统,支持发送消息、接收信息及退出房间等操作。设计这样一个实时通信的功能需要考虑到并发处理的效率问题,并且在用户体验上也需要精心打磨,这对于初学者来说是一个不小的挑战。 5. **默认页面**:Default.aspx作为网站的主要入口点,通常会包含导航菜单和欢迎语句等内容。这一页是用户首次访问时所看到的第一个界面,在设计方面应该注重引导性和易用性。 6. **配置文件**:Web.config不仅用于管理用户的会话状态,还可能包含了数据库连接字符串、错误处理策略以及安全设置等信息。熟悉该配置文件的结构和功能对于网站的维护与优化非常有帮助。 7. **安全实践**:在设计实际购物网站时,安全性是至关重要的因素之一。例如通过参数化查询防止SQL注入攻击,使用HTTPS协议保护用户数据传输的安全性,并且限制不被允许使用的HTTP方法等措施都是必要的。虽然这些内容在这篇文档中没有详细说明,但对于开发者而言理解和执行最佳安全实践是非常关键的。 总之,通过对该项目的研究和实施,学生可以深入理解ASP编程、数据库交互技术以及会话管理等方面的核心概念,并有机会将其应用到实际项目开发当中去。同时它也为进一步学习ASP.NET框架以及其他现代Web开发方法打下了坚实的基础。
  • 算机专作品报告模板及格式
    优质
    本报告为计算机专业学生进行网站开发毕业设计时提供指导,涵盖设计、实现和文档编写等环节的标准模板与格式规范。 通过参考毕业设计作品模板,可以快速撰写毕业设计报告。
  • 基于Spring MVC、Hibernate和Spring的糖果适用于
    优质
    本项目为基于Spring MVC框架结合Hibernate持久层方案及Spring核心容器实现的一个糖果电商平台,提供完整源代码,特别适合于高校计算机专业学生进行毕业设计研究与实践。 Spring MVC + Hibernate + Spring 开发的糖果电子商务类整站源码适用于毕业设计项目。
  • 利用HTML、CSS和JavaScript衣帽
    优质
    本项目为一款集成了HTML、CSS及JavaScript技术的衣帽商城网站,旨在通过前端技能实现用户友好的界面与流畅的操作体验。 1. 如果您下载了某些HTML模板但不知道如何进行修改,请尝试使用Dreamweaver网站制作软件,并通过百度搜索该软件的下载链接并安装。打开后可以利用可视化操作来编辑网页。 2. 由于较早版本的IE浏览器不支持HTML5和CSS3技术,因此在较低版本如IE6、7、8中查看部分HTML5模板时可能会出现布局错位的问题,请改用最新版的Chrome谷歌浏览器或者使用360/搜狗等主流浏览器的极速模式进行浏览。 3. 如果您不清楚如何修改网页内容的话,可以参考在线教程来学习相关知识。例如在B站上有一个视频教程可以帮助大家入门:BV1We4y1L7CS 4. 对于需要翻译插件的朋友来说,请按照以下步骤操作: - 首先下载并解压缩文件到新的文件夹。 - 将cpx后缀名更改为zip格式,然后再次进行解压。 - 接下来打开谷歌浏览器的扩展程序管理页面,并点击“加载已解压的扩展程序”按钮来安装刚刚提取出来的插件。
  • :ASP的构建(含
    优质
    本作品为基于ASP技术搭建的电子商务网站的完整设计与实现,涵盖从需求分析到系统测试的所有环节,并包含完整的源代码。 为了更好地服务广大消费者,我公司开发了一个功能实用且高效的网站平台。该网站不仅为顾客提供购物的便利,还用于对外宣传我们的形象,并展示我们忠诚的服务态度。通过这个平台,我们可以开启与外界交流的大门,吸引更多的关注者来了解公司的动态和发展情况。 此网站集成了多种功能于一体,包括但不限于商品交易、信息分享等服务。 客户端模块如下: - 用户注册和管理 - 商品上架及分类展示 - 购物车操作界面 - 产品搜索工具 服务器端的管理员模块则涵盖了会员资料的查询与维护(如添加、修改或删除记录)等功能。 技术要求方面,用户端需要使用Windows 98及以上版本的操作系统以及Internet Explorer浏览器4.0以上的版本。而服务端则需安装Windows 2000/XP操作系统及IIS5.0以上版本,并配合Access数据库进行数据管理与支持。 在系统设计时,我们采用模块化页面和代码重用策略来提高开发效率并保证系统的稳定性和可扩展性。具体来说: - 页面元素如头部、尾部以及数据库连接文件均被封装为独立的模板; - 开发过程中尽量利用已有的代码资源以减少重复劳动。 这些设计理念确保了网站能够高效运行,并且易于维护和更新,从而更好地服务于广大用户群体。
  • []PHP企(含及论文).zip
    优质
    本资源包含一份完整的PHP企业网站开发项目,包括前端界面设计、后端逻辑实现以及数据库管理等内容。附带详细的设计文档和毕业论文,提供全面的技术指导和理论支持。适合学习参考使用。 毕业设计:PHP企业门户网站开发与设计(包含源代码及论文)